The planned merger between Total Access Communication Plc (DTAC) and True Corporation Plc should be suspended because it would scale up mobile market dominance, jeopardising consumers and hindering the country’s journey towards a digital economy, according to academics and consumer advocates. They shared their views at an online seminar on the proposed merger between the two carriers and the role of the board of the National Broadcasting and Telecommunications Commission (NBTC). The seminar was organised yesterday by the Thailand Consumers Council. NO MERIT Somkiat Tangkitvanich, president of …
